Scarlett Johansson in Negotiations for Leading Role in Upcoming Jurassic World Film

In the world of blockbuster filmmaking, it is not uncommon for stars to switch franchises and take on new roles. Scarlett Johansson, who has been a staple of the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U) for years, is reportedly in talks to star in an upcoming Jurassic World movie. The film will be directed by Gareth Edwards and written by David Koepp, who wrote the original Jurassic Park.

Johansson’s involvement in the new film is not confirmed yet, but fans of both the actress and the Jurassic Park franchise are excited about the possibility. Edwards is an experienced director, having worked on blockbusters like Godzilla and Rogue One: A Star Wars Story. The movie is set to be released on July 2, 2025, but many details still need to be ironed out before production begins.

The upcoming Jurassic World movie will need to find a way to follow up on the previous trilogy led by Chris Pratt and Bryce Dallas Howard. The latest installment, Jurassic World: Dominion, was released in June 2022 and received generally positive reviews. If Johansson signs on for a role in this new film, it could be a big step for her career as she moves away from her iconic role as Black Widow in the MCU.
